Who is Petra Horáková Krištofová

Petra Horáková Krištofová is an entrepreneur and philanthropist. She founded the Apolena Endowment Fund to support the endoscopy rooms at the gynecology and obstetrics clinic U Apolináře in Prague. In 2020, she fulfilled a childhood dream by joining the active reserve of the Czech Army, where she serves in the 91st information warfare group. She is a mother of two daughters who manages to balance business, family, and service in uniform. She shares her experiences from military training and reserve service through the blog and podcast Deník vojínky. This fall, a book of the same name was published. For her inspiring integration of career, family, and the military, she received the Lady Pro award in 2024 in the prestigious Czech 100 Best poll.
